17th January 2014 - During a routine inspection pdf icon

During our inspection we spoke with the provider, one dentist and three members of staff. We looked at care records for five patients, and spoke with three patients.

We saw that patient’s views were taken into account in the way the service was provided and delivered. For example one patient told us “They have offered me options to choose from and give me time to consider them.” Another patient said “I like it here it’s very good.”

Patient's needs were assessed and care and treatment was planned and delivered in line with their individual care plans in accordance with General Dental Council (GDC) guidance. This meant that patients received individualised oral care and treatment that they had agreed to.

We saw that the premises were visibly clean and tidy. Staff we spoke with spoke knowledgeably about decontamination and sterilisation processes they used. All the patients we spoke with told us that the practice was always clean. One patient we spoke with said “It’s (the practice) always clean and tidy.”

We saw documentation which confirmed that all relevant staff employed by the service held current registrations with the GDC. We also saw documents which confirmed that the service held checks with the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) for all staff. This meant that the service had taken reasonable steps to identify the possibility of abuse and prevent abuse from happening.
